The first 'Evening Gratitude Meditation' was one of his most successful recordings. It was chosen to be featured and has been downloaded almost twenty thousand times. This is a new and improved version, with an improved meditation, new affirmations and professionally recorded. Unwind just before with this recording, and it will start to active the search for things to be grateful for in your life. When you become more grateful, you will become happier. Use this meditation to wind down and ease yourself into a deeply restorative sleep,

One that will fill your heart with gratitude and set you up for a beautiful tomorrow.

Lie down on your back in a quiet space,

Arms out to the side,

Palms facing upwards.

Stretch your legs out with the heels apart by about 8-12 inches,

Allowing the feet to fall out of the sockets and allow your eyes to gently close.

Make any last movements to get the body even more comfortable and relax.

Feel the weight of your body sinking into peace,

Allowing gravity to release the day's tension.

Feel the top of the head,

What can you feel here,

And allow it to relax,

Relaxing the scalp,

Sweep that sense of awareness and relaxation down into the forehead and then into your eyes,

Letting the eyes gently drop back into the sockets,

No holding.

Check in with the jaw,

Is there any tension,

Allow the jaw to fall open.

Feel the entire face relaxing,

Letting go,

Letting go,

Letting go.

Relax your throat and then the back of your neck,

Release any tension in your shoulders.

Let your arms fall out of the shoulder sockets,

No need to hold them in.

Relax your upper arms,

Then your lower arms,

Place your attention into the palms of your hands.

What sensations do you notice in the hands?

The hands are fully alive,

Filled with sensation,

That we miss,

Explore this now and relax your fingers out of the sockets,

Letting go,

Letting go,

Letting go.

Feel the heaviness of the body against the floor,

Relax your chest,

Relax your abdomen,

Let go of any holding that you might find here,

You can hold on to so much tension in the abdomen,

Let it go.

Notice the gentle movements that happen with each breath,

Notice the swell of the abdomen,

The rising as the breath comes in and the falling as the breath leaves the body.

You can say to yourself,

Rising,

Falling,

With each in and out breath.

Now place your attention on the back,

What can you feel,

Maybe the shoulder blades connected with the surface you are resting on,

Perhaps tension in the lower back,

Let gravity pull this out of the body,

Sink deeper into the bed or floor,

Letting go.

Feel the buttocks pressed into the surface you are resting on and release any holding,

Feel the thighs,

What sensations are here in the thighs,

Feel them relaxing and feel the calves pressed into the bed or floor,

Allow them to relax,

And relax the feet,

The toes,

Let your legs become heavy,

Your feet and your toes and now feel the entire body,

The whole body,

A heavy relaxed body,

Surrendering to gravity and now you move back to focusing on the breath,

Feeling the expansion and contraction of the body,

Sense the body inflating and then deflating effortlessly,

As you breathe in,

Say silently to yourself,

Rising,

As you breathe out,

Falling,

Rising,

Falling,

Rest in the breath,

Resting your attention on the breath,

When your mind wanders,

Gently bring it back to the breath,

Rising,

Falling,

Notice that the breath is like a calm ocean on a warm still evening,

Like a gentle tide,

Feel the breath coming in,

Filling you with life and the breath leaving,

Deepening your relaxation,
